Women's Basketball: Raiders Score Season-High in Second Straight Win

Box Score

ALLIANCE, Ohio – Mount Union's women's basketball team scored a season-high 100 points in a 100-70 Ohio Athletic Conference win over Muskingum Wednesday at Timken Gymnasium.

It was the first time the Purple Raiders crossed the century mark since a 104-66 win over Waynesburg on Nov. 22, 2013.

Mount Union (8-6, 2-5 OAC) had 12 different players score with freshman Madison Hensley (Gahanna / Lincoln) posting a game-high 20 points, shooting 7-of-10 from the floor.

Four other Raiders scored in double digits as junior Elena Rauhe (Parma / Padua Franciscan) had 16, freshman Anika Sweeney (Sylvania / Northview) had 15, junior Brianna Gassman (Minerva) and Hailey Peoples-O'Neil (Geneva) each had 11 points.

Casey Smith had 17 to lead Muskingum (3-9, 1-6 OAC).

Mount Union scored 21 of the game's first 30 points and never looked back leading 23-18 after one quarter. The Raiders made 15 field goals in the second quarter with seven of them from beyond the arc and led 62-27 at the break.

The Raiders remain at home to host Otterbein in an OAC matchup Saturday, Jan. 18 at 3 p.m. in Alliance.
